    When using a CRT, the phosphor is painted on the display much more widely. The maximum resolutions used are always far less than the maximum the display could produce IF we were to tune it to absolutely perfectly hit every Phosphor dot. But if you did this, you would have to adjust your display ever time a new picture went up on it.
    An LCD display does not wave an electron gun around and light up some phosphor dots. The dots are addressed directly. Optimum resolution is EXACTLY every dot that the manufacturer placed on the glass -- no more, no less.
    If you chose any resolution other than the optimum resolution, the display may try to approximate what you asked for and fill the display -- or may not. If it does fill the screen, it will be a poor imitation of the best picture you can possibly get from the display.
    My recommendation: Find out what is the optimum or recommended resolution is for your specific display, set your display to that resolution, and do not change it.

    Zoom is your best bet. To make it work for you, I have two suggestions.
    (1) Switch from "text only" zoom to "full page" zoom. This is proportional like in IE.
    View menu > Zoom > ''uncheck'' Zoom Text Only
    If you are using the compact menus with the orange Firefox button, tap the Alt key to display the full classic menu bar.
    (2) Install an extension that can default your view to a higher zoom level automatically to save time when visiting new sites. Here are two candidates:
